Violation Tracker Individual Record

Company: Acuity, A Mutual Insurance Company
Penalty: $52,000
Year: 2018
Date: January 19, 2018
Offense Group: consumer-protection-related offenses
Primary Offense: insurance violation
Level of Government: state
Action Type: agency action
Agency: Minnesota Department of Commerce
Civil or Criminal Case: civil
Facility State: Minnesota
Source of Data(click here)
Notes: Penalty was a $5,000 civil penalty and $47,000 to claimant over an alleged failure to provide notice before the statue of limitations on a claim ran out.
